Sometimes the simplest stories are the most effective, and this old-fashioned adventure is a fine example. Barry Pepper gives a memorable performance as a self-centred war veteran-turned-bush pilot who agrees to fly a sickly young Inuit woman (Annabella Piugattuk) to hospital. When his plane crashes, leaving them stranded in Canada's arctic tundra and unlikely to be rescued, a bond develops between these two people from different cultures as they struggle to overcome the elements. There are few surprises, but it's a poignant, moving journey and the scenery is hauntingly beautiful. Worth a look.
